Black and White Garifuna Restaurant and Cultural Center.

Black and White Garifuna Restaurant serves as a vital cultural outpost on Ambergris Caye, offering much more than a standard dinner service. Founded by Julia Martinez to preserve and share her heritage, the space functions as both an eatery and an informal museum. The menu focuses on labor-intensive traditional dishes like hudut—a rich fish and coconut stew—along with cassava bread and green banana tamales known as darasa. Between courses, the experience is highly educational; guests can browse historical artwork, watch video presentations on Garifuna history, or watch live drumming and junkunu dance performances. The venue itself is spread across an outdoor garden and a multi-room bar, creating a communal atmosphere where you might find yourself learning the rhythm of ancestral drums or taking a cooking lesson. It is a straightforward, soulful spot for those looking to swap the typical beach resort aesthetic for authentic Belizean history.
